
Valverde and Tchouaméni feud: Real Madrid opens investigation ahead of El Clásico
Real Madrid announces disciplinary measures
Real Madrid announced in an official statement released today, Thursday, that they have opened an investigation and initiated disciplinary proceedings against two of their midfielders, Uruguayan Federico Valverde and Frenchman Aurélien Tchouaméni. This decision follows a heated altercation between the two players during a first-team training session, raising concerns within the club just days before the highly anticipated El Clásico match.
The club issued a statement saying: “Real Madrid announces that, following the events that occurred this morning during the first team’s training session, the club has decided to open disciplinary proceedings against Federico Valverde and Aurelien Tchouaméni.” The statement added that the club will announce its final decisions once the relevant internal investigations are completed, emphasizing its seriousness in addressing the incident.
Details and repercussions of the fight before El Clásico
According to reports in the Spanish newspaper AS, the roots of the dispute lie in a verbal altercation during yesterday's training session, but things escalated dramatically today. The crisis began when Valverde refused to shake hands with Tchouaméni in the locker room, creating a tense atmosphere that spilled onto the pitch. During the final part of the training session, after an exchange of heated words, the situation deteriorated into a physical confrontation described by the newspaper as "very serious," requiring the swift intervention of their teammates to separate them.
The clash resulted in Valverde sustaining a facial injury, requiring him to be taken to the hospital for treatment and to stop the bleeding, in a shocking scene that reflects the level of tension that may prevail in the dressing room of one of the world's biggest clubs.
